What's the outlook for BRIC country currencies?

By Enrique DÍAZ-ALVAREZ, Matthew RYAN, CFA, Roman ZIRUK, Itsaso APEZTEGUIA, Eduardo MOUTINHO Michal JÓZWIAK, Ebury   We’ve witnessed a broad rebound in risk currencies since the beginning of October, as markets double down on expectations that the Federal Reserve is done raising interest rates, and as Chinese economic data takes a moderate turn for the better. This has allowed most emerging market currencies to recover ground on the dollar, recouping some of their losses following a period of general strength in the latter in the third quarter of the year. The MSCI Emerging Market Currency Index has subsequently rallied to near-four month highs, while the JP Morgan Emerging Market Currency Index is currently trading at its highest level since late-August....
